Identity

CAS Number

1793003-65-2

Chemical name

4-(1-Cyano-1-methylethyl)-2-fluorophenylboronic acid

Molecular formula

C10H11BFNO2

Molecular weight

207.01 g/mol

Synonyms

[4-(1-cyano-1-methylethyl)-2-fluorophenyl]boronic acid; (4-(2-cyanopropan-2-yl)-2-fluorophenyl)boronic acid; F88212; F623266; 4-(1-Cyano-1-methylethyl)-2-fluorophenylboronicacid; [4-(1-cyano-1-methyl-ethyl)-2-fluoro-phenyl]boronic acid

InChIKey

PYLDACORZHNYTJ-UHFFFAOYSA-N

PubChem CID

74788322

Handling & PPE

  • Handle in a well-ventilated area or fume hood.
  • Avoid contact with skin, eyes, and clothing.
  • Keep container tightly closed in a dry, cool, and well-ventilated place.
  • Store away from incompatible materials such as strong oxidizing agents.
  • Wear a lab coat or other protective clothing.
  • Wear compatible protective gloves (e.g., nitrile or neoprene).
  • Wear eye protection (e.g., safety goggles or face shield).
  • Use respiratory protection if ventilation is inadequate or if dust/aerosol is generated.
  • Dispose of contents and container in accordance with local, regional, national, and international regulations.

First Aid / Accidental Release

  • If inhaled, move to fresh air. If not breathing, give artificial respiration.
  • In case of skin contact, wash thoroughly with soap and water.
  • In case of eye contact, rinse cautiously with water for several minutes. Remove contact lenses, if present and easy to do. Continue rinsing.
  • If swallowed, rinse mouth with water. Do NOT induce vomiting.
  • Seek medical attention if irritation persists or symptoms develop.
  • Evacuate personnel to safe areas.
  • Avoid dust formation and do not breathe dust.
  • Wear appropriate personal protective equipment.
  • Sweep up or absorb with inert material and place in suitable closed containers for disposal.

Firefighting / Stability

  • Use water spray, dry chemical, carbon dioxide, or appropriate foam for extinction.
  • Wear self-contained breathing apparatus (SCBA) and full protective gear.
  • Cool unopened containers with water spray.
  • Prevent fire-fighting water from entering drains or waterways.
  • Stable under recommended storage conditions.
  • Avoid strong oxidizing agents, strong acids, and strong bases.
  • Hazardous decomposition products may include carbon oxides, nitrogen oxides, boron oxides, and hydrogen fluoride.
  • No known hazardous reactions under normal conditions of use.
